COURSE DESCRIPTION:
- The course aims to enhance advanced algebraic skills for high school students, facilitating preparation for higher-level mathematics.
- Key topics encompass polynomial functions, exponential and logarithmic equations, matrices, and conic sections.
- Emphasis is placed on problem-solving techniques and their applications in real-world scenarios.
- Students will develop their mathematical reasoning and analytical abilities.
- This foundation is crucial for achieving success in calculus and other advanced mathematical courses.

LEARNING OUTCOMES:
By the conclusion of the course, participants will possess the skills to:
- Master higher-degree polynomial equations and their graphical representations.
- Simplify and solve rational expressions and equations effectively.
- Explore real-world applications by solving exponential and logarithmic equations.
- Understand matrix operations to resolve systems of equations.
- Analyze parabolas, ellipses, and hyperbolas through algebraic methods.
